BETHLEHEM TWP., Pa. — A motor vehicle crash on State Highway 173 West sent multiple individuals to the hospital Monday afternoon.
According to New Jersey State Police, the collision occurred around 4:30 p.m. involving a Jeep SUV and a Kia. Preliminary investigations indicate the Jeep was turning right when it was rear-ended by the Kia.
One child in the backseat of the Jeep suffered serious injuries and was transported to a local hospital. Both drivers, along with seven other passengers, sustained minor injuries and were also taken to a hospital for treatment.
The incident remains under investigation, and further information has not yet been released.
